激光彩色墨粉制备方法研究进展

摘    要:随着对打印品质要求的提高,高质量彩色墨粉的市场需求量越来越大。本文综述了目前激光彩色墨粉的各种制备方法及其优缺点,介绍了聚合法中的乳液聚合和悬浮聚合制备彩色墨粉的方法及研究进展,重点阐述了悬浮聚合法制备墨粉的生产工艺方法及进展,最后对未来墨粉生产工艺及方法进行了展望。作者认为乳液聚合型彩色墨粉具有高分辨率、高色彩饱和度和适宜的固结性能,它将会取代悬浮聚合型彩色墨粉,成为未来墨粉市场的发展趋势。

Research on laser color toner preparation methods

Abstract:With the requirement for high quality printing,the market demand for high quality color toner will also increase.The preparation methods of the laser color toner were reviewed in this article,and emulsion polymerization and suspension polymerization methods and their research progress for preparing color toner were highlighted,the future technology and methods for toner producing were prospected.The authors believed that the color toner produced by emulsion polymerization can provide higher resolution,higher color saturation and suitable consolidation property;it will replace those produced by suspension polymerization and become a lead in the future market of color toner.
